She was born May 13, 1827. Her maiden name was Indgold and she with her brothers and sisters lived with the parents at home until November 17, 1845 at which time she married Tim Hamel, with whoom she lived until Jan. 27, 1857, when death claimed her husband. the fruits of this marriage were six children, five of whom survive their mother. Mrs. Hamel made her way alone providing for her fatherless children as best she culd until July 30, 1857, which time she married George Long, who survives her.
